Output ccf52d1deb8b5de733b5c2960d7395fd18a7be752fc9c091ee1ef1a07f395ff1:8

value
1984000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83679cf98e173371c64e17f8070dfea8c5091fba OP_EQUAL
address
3DfpZqtT6RpL8431K7rUADVUgjrd97M28A
transaction
ccf52d1deb8b5de733b5c2960d7395fd18a7be752fc9c091ee1ef1a07f395ff1
confirmations
293285
spent
true